Section 2.5 Proving Statements about Segments and Angles 101 Using Properties of Congruence The reasons used in a proof can include de! nitions, properties, postulates, and theorems. A theorem is a statement that can be proven. Once you have proven a theorem, you can use the theorem as a reason in other proofs. Naming Properties of Congruence

A key component of this postulate (that is easy to get mistaken) is that the angle. must be formed by the two pairs of congruent, corresponding sides of the triangles.Notice the distinction between the above examples. Example 1.1 is an unknown angle problem because its answer is a number: d = 102 is the number of degrees for the unknown angle. We call Example 1.2 an unknown angle proof because the conclusion d = 180 − b is a relationship between angles whose size is not specified.
